The Log Lady

Today marks one year since the death of Catherine E. Coulson. Here’s a mini tribute.

Margaret (The Log Lady) was arguably the most popular character in David Lynch’s show Twin Peaks, always seeming to understand the mystery and humanity more than anyone elseShe even appeared in Muppet form on Sesame Street’s Twin Beaks

Sesame Street's Twin Beaks
Sesame Street’s Twin Beaks

We hope you’re having a wonderful time, wherever you are.

Television Shows That Changed Our Lives, 1970-2010: Great Moments and Guilty Pleasures